The best way to look at it is to create an Organizational structure based on the various functions you have to fulfill as a Sole Proprietor, or Internet Entrepreneur, to be more specific.
For the sake of completeness, here is are some of primary functions you have to perform (as if you didn’t know it!)
- You’re the President and the Chief Operating Officer, accountable for the overall achievement of your Strategic Objective. This is crucial. Because a lot of people sometimes make the mistake that it’s their company or sponsor who is responsible for their performance and results. As we’ve discussed in earlier videos and articles, the business which you are selling is only a means, a vehicle, for you to achieve your Primary Aim. And you are solely responsible for your own results, using the business and your sponsor to help you achieve those results.
- You are also responsible for Marketing, Operations and Finance matters and Research. The best way is to create a Position Contract for each of these positions.
A Position Contract is simply a document that identifies who’s accountable for each position and what they’re being counted on to produce. Then put your signature on the document for each of these positions because you fill each of these positions.
You hold yourself accountable for each of the requirements of these positions and ensure that you achieve them.
It’s essential to document everything that’s required and what’s needs doing to achieve those requirements.
